blob: c1493632af1dcb11f90135c65eb07bfa89594971 [file] [log] [blame]
Martin Polreich5ec9e542018-07-17 13:54:55 +02001gerrit:
2 client:
3 enabled: true
4 project:
5 test_salt_project:
6 enabled: true
7 access:
8 "refs/heads/*":
9 actions:
10 - name: abandon
11 group: openstack-salt-core
12 - name: create
13 group: openstack-salt-release
14 labels:
15 - name: Code-Review
16 group: openstack-salt-core
17 score: -2..+2
18 - name: Workflow
19 group: openstack-salt-core
20 score: -1..+1
21 "refs/tags/*":
22 actions:
23 - name: pushSignedTag
24 group: openstack-salt-release
25 force: true
26 inherit_access: All-Projects
27 require_change_id: true
28 require_agreement: true
29 merge_content: true
30 action: "fast forward only"
Ivan Berezovskiy59484c02019-07-09 14:20:26 +040031 test_library:
32 enabled: true
33 description: library
34 upstream_secured: true
35 protocol: https
36 username: foo
37 password: bar
38 address: github.com/repo/library
39 access:
40 "refs/heads/*":
41 actions:
42 - name: abandon
43 group: core-team
44 - name: create
45 group: release-team
46 labels:
47 - name: Code-Review
48 group: core-team
49 score: -2..+2
50 - name: Workflow
51 group: core-team
52 score: -1..+1
53 "refs/tags/*":
54 actions:
55 - name: pushSignedTag
56 group: release-team
57 force: true
58 inherit_access: All-Projects
59 require_change_id: true
60 require_agreement: false
61 merge_content: true
Martin Polreich5ec9e542018-07-17 13:54:55 +020062 server:
63 user: "jdoe"
64 password: "passw0rd"
65 email: "jdoe@email.com"
66 host: 0.0.0.0
67 protocol: "http"
68 http_port: 80
Martin Polreich7e82eab2018-12-20 14:27:00 +010069 ssh_port: 22
70 key: "key"